    Unless you’re a trained contractor, the majority of roofing jobs should not be undertaken yourself. In addition always remember that a large number of manufacturers of products utilized in the roof repair won’t warranty those products unless a licensed roofing contractor performs the work. The other thing to always remember is that working on a roof can be very dangerous, so is it really worth endangering your health in order to save money?

    Due to the fact that your roof is constantly exposed to the weather, it means your roof is going to diminish over time. The pace at which it deteriorates will be dependent on a range of factors. Those include; the quality of the initial materials used along with the workmanship, the level of abuse it has to take from the weather, how well the roof is taken care of and the type of roof. Most roofing companies will quote around 20 years for a well-built and properly maintained roof, but that can never be guaranteed due to the above variables. Our advice is to consistently keep your roof well maintained and get regular inspections to be sure it lasts as long as possible.

    You should never pressure-wash your roof, as you run the risk of getting rid of any covering minerals that have been included to give shielding from the elements. Furthermore, you really should try to stay away from chlorine-based bleach cleaning products as they can also lower the lifespan of your roof. When you talk to your roof cleaning expert, tell them to use an EPA-approved algaecide/fungicide to wash your roof. This will get rid of the unattractive algae and discoloration without ruining the tile or shingles.

    Lutz /ˈluːts/ is an unincorporated census-designated place (CDP) in Hillsborough County, Florida, United States. It is fifteen miles north of Tampa. The northern part of Lutz also makes up a portion of south Pasco County. The population was 19,344 at the 2010 census.[3]

    Lutz began with the construction of a small train depot on the Tampa Northern Railroad. The area surrounding the depot officially became known as “Lutz” when the U.S. Postal Service authorized a post office. The community was named for W. P. Lutz, who was credited with bringing the railroad to town.[4]

    How To Choose A Reliable Roof Specialist For Your Own Home

    leaking-roof-in
    The key function of your homes roof is always to shelter you and your family and friends from the rain, wind, snow, and harsh summer sun. Having a well-maintained roof is vital if you wish to build a home that is certainly safe and comfy.

    Unfortunately, roofing materials don’t last forever. All roofs must be repaired or replaced at some time or any other. Unless you will find the right tools and experience to do the project yourself, that usually means working with a professional roofing company.

    The importance of hiring the right company can’t be overstated. Most roofing projects are very expensive. You have to know you are investing your hard earned money wisely and that the finished roof will last for several years ahead. Have a look at these guidelines on how to look for a reliable roof specialist for your home:

    1. Employ a local company. Before getting a contractor, be sure that these people have a physical address in your city or county. Local contractors are more likely to know about the codes and building requirements in the area. Also, they are unlikely to try to scam you from your money since they need to maintain their reputation in your community.

    2. Verify the contractor is licensed and insured. Reputable contractors always make time to get licensed. You will be able to check out licensing information online through the website of the city or state. Check to ensure that the contractor’s license applies and that it is current prior to hiring them. Additionally, ask the contractor to deliver evidence of liability insurance and worker’s compensation insurance before they begin work.

    3. Solicit competing quotes. Don’t make your mistake of hiring the very first company which you contact. Instead, reach out to a minimum of some different contractors in your neighborhood to acquire quotes for your roofing project. Ask each contractor to provide you with an itemized quote to be able to see specifically where your cash is certainly going. Ideally, they ought to send a representative to your property to examine your homes roof in person before offering you an insurance quote. Like that, the estimate they give is going to be considerably more accurate.

    4. Ensure that the clients are trustworthy by reading through reviews from the past clients. Consider checking with groups like the Better Business Bureau (BBB) to verify that no major complaints happen to be filed against them.

    5. Get everything in writing. Don’t just take a contractor at their word. Instead, ask them to provide you with a written contract. Make certain both you and also the contractor sign the contract. Keep a copy for yourself in the event that any problems or disputes arise. A signed contract reduces the risk of misunderstandings and gives you legal protection in case the contractor fails to follow through on their own promises.

    Deciding on a reliable roofing contractor for your home is extremely important. Your roof is among the most critical components of your home. Hiring a professional roofer who has an excellent reputation is the easiest method to ensure that the project goes as planned.
